Chate Leavult is a high-population, pre-rich world with a billion or more sophonts in population size.

  • It lacks adequate resources to expand its economy to a rich status.
  • Its economy and population are rapidly growing and living conditions are expected to quickly rise barring outside forces.
  • It is a member of the Federation of Alsas in the Alsas Subsector of Far Frontiers Sector.

World Starport (St)[edit]

Chate Leavult has a Class C Starport, an average quality installation which includes amenities including unrefined fuel for starships, some brokerage services for passengers and cargo, and a variety of ship provisions. There is a shipyard capable of doing maintenance and other kinds of repair. Ports of this classification generally have only a downport, unless this is a trade port or system with an hostile environment mainworld.

Military[edit]

As with most member planets of the Federation of Alsas, this world leaves the job of Federation defence to the armed forces of Afellahlah, thereby avoiding the expense of equipping itself but allowing the Afellahlah government a lot of leeway in deciding Federation policy.
